Music Theory: Foundations 1 – UC APPROVED
COURSE DESCRIPTION: Music Theory: Foundations 1 is a continuation of the Music Theory beginner courses and builds on the concepts of reading and writing music. This semester also targets ear training for intervals, giving students the tools to better identify what they hear when listening to music. Students can expect to learn about theoretical concepts and hear clear examples of these ideas in real world settings. By more fully understanding the building blocks of music, students open themselves up to new worlds of learning and playing music.

COURSE OVERVIEW:
Lesson 1: Major and Minor Key Signatures, Circle of Fifths
- A (very) brief history of accidentals and key signatures
- Key signatures
- Sharp key signatures
- Flat key signatures
- Circle of Fifths
Lesson 2: Relative and Parallel Relationship
- Relative relationships
- Parallel relationships
Lesson 3: Intervals
- Melodic and Harmonic Intervals
- Interval Quality
- Diatonic intervals in the major scale
- Diatonic intervals in the natural minor scale
- Ear training
Lesson 4: Intervals Part II
- Review of intervals
- Augmented and diminished intervals
- Minor 2nds, tritones, and unisons
- Enharmonic equivalents
- Consonant and dissonant intervals
- Interval reference charts and songs for intervals
Lesson 5: Interval Inversion
- Interval inversions
- Inverting intervals
- Inverted interval quality
